Aprirose acquires Revolution bars
Property investor Aprirose has acquired leaseholds on nine freehold Revolution vodka bars from Inventive Leisure for £17m.
The properties are based in Huddersfield, Lancaster, Leicester, Lincoln, Liverpool, Newcastle-under-Lyme and Wolverhampton plus two in Manchester. Christie + Co advised Aprirose – which owns a £300m portfolio that includes hotels, pubs and restaurants – on the 25-year lessee deal.
Christie & Co’s director, Jon Patrick, said: “The Inventive sale and leaseback portfolio comprised over 80,000sq ft of good-quality real estate, with rental levels set at a realistic proportion of profits. This should enable Inventive to maintain investment in the units in the future.”
